About Ping Koy Lam

Ping Koy Lam is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Artificial Intelligence,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Astronomy and Astrophysics and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 266 papers that have together received 8.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Quantum Information and Cryptography (159 papers), Quantum Mechanics and Applications (98 papers), Quantum optics and atomic interactions (68 papers), Quantum Computing Algorithms and Architecture (67 papers), Cold Atom Physics and Bose-Einstein Condensates (43 papers), Mechanical and Optical Resonators (38 papers),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(36 papers) and Photonic and Optical Devices (31 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Acoustics and Ultrasonics (260 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(7.8k citations), Artificial Intelligence (6.0k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.4k citations) and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(246 citations). Ping Koy Lam has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, Singapore and United States. Frequent co-authors include Warwick P. Bowen, Timothy C. Ralph, B. C. Buchler, Thomas Symul, Hans‐A. Bachor, Roman Schnabel, Andrew M. Lance, Nicolas Treps, Geoff Campbell and D. E. McClelland.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review A, Physical Review Letters, Physical review. A, Nature Communications and Optics Express.
